November 22, 1996

Faustian Bargains

Inspired by a spate of new Chicago stage adaptations of the Faust story, This American Life brings you stories of people who made a deal with the devil.

Act One

Dangerous Minds

LuAnne Johnson is a teacher who sold her story to Hollywood and saw it made into the film and TV series Dangerous Minds, in which a character named LuAnne Johnson does things the real LuAnne believes are unethical and silly. (15 minutes)

By

Ira Glass
Act Two

The Undiscovered Country

Found tape of a conversation about bringing back the dead. (11 minutes)

By

Ira Glass
Act Three

Voyager

Alix Spiegel tells the story of her friend Jayna, who made a Faustian bargain at 11 years old. (12 minutes)

By

Alix Spiegel
Act Four

Carmen Becomes Faust

Carmen Delzell on a deal she made with the devil when she turned 30. (14 minutes)

By

Carmen Delzell
Act Five

First Contact

Daniel Pinkwater reads his children's picture book Devil in the Drain. (4 minutes)
